About this property

3-bedroom house near Lake Michigan in charming Shorewood. Family & Pet friendly

Bring the whole family to this lower level duplex with lots of room for fun. Just blocks from Atwater Park and beach. University Of Wisconsin Milwaukee is a 2 min drive or .7 mile walk. Walk to restaurants, bars, cafes, nail and hair salons, parks and shopping. Three bedrooms, kitchen, dining and living room. Child/Infant friendly with crib, high chair and jogging stroller available. Pets welcome. Quiet neighborhood for a walk or run. Ideal for extended stay. Separate Guest washer and dryer.

As you enter the home into the living area there is space to land with coats and belongings. You then enter the living room and front sitting room where there is a smart TV and multiple sitting areas.

Next to the living room is the dining room with a table that seats 6, glass built ins with wine glasses and other barware. There are books, puzzles, and games for all ages on the shelves.

There is a full kitchen with a large gas stove and oven, full sized refrigerator with ice and water in the door, a microwave over the stove, and a Bosch dishwasher. In the cabinets you will find a variety of small appliances, bakeware, pots and pans. There is tableware, glassware and silverware, including plastic for young children.

Three bedrooms sleep six and a standard crib or toddler bed is available on request. There is a King bed and two double beds. Bedroom 3 has a fold out couch in addition to a double bed.

The bathroom has a tub with shower, a hairdryer, all the basic amenities and plenty of towels for everyone.

There is a separate full sized washer and dryer on property for guest use.

The backyard has outdoor furniture to relax, a table with an umbrella and 4 chairs, and a charcoal grill.
